September 2009 PRC Chemist Board Exam Results

The  September 2009 Chemist Board Exam Results has been released. Interestingly, 292 out of 544 examinees (53.68%) passed the chemist board exams given during the first week of September with a La Salle University graduate leading the the list.

Listed below are the Top 10 of the September 2009 Chemist Board Exams:

  1. Marc Rhyan Anthony Jimenez Puno from La Salle University, 90%
  2. William Wang Manalastas Jr., from La Salle University, 89.75%
  3. Amster Fei Pua Baquiran from University of the Philippines – Diliman, 89%
  4. Melissa Antonette Elizda Santiago from University of the Philippines – Los Banos, 88.75%
  5. Jhon Ralph dela Pena Enterian from Xavier University, 88%
  6. Shyne de Vera Galapon from University of the Philippines – Diliman, 87. 50% and Jon Philippe Ng Go from the University of Santo Toma, 87.50%
  7. Reece Joreim del Guzman Hugo and Kiall Francis Gadilan Suazo, both from University of the Philippines -Diliman, 87.25%
  8. Arlou Kristina Joingco Angeles from University of the Philippines – Manila, 86.75% and Samuel Anthon Prudente Bello from University of Southern Mindanao – Kabacan, 86.75%
  9. Angel Tugade Bautista VII from University of the Philippines – Diliman, 86.50%
  10. Mario Tiongosia Rosete III from University of the Philippines – Manila, 86.00%

The Professional Regulation Commission (PRC) also announced that the oath-taking of the successful examinees will be held on October 16 at 1 p.m. at the Centennial Hall of the Manila Hotel.
